The ___________ has been described as a means of benefiting the

producer tat the expense of the consumer.

Final answer:

Protectionism is a method of requiring consumers to subsidize producers, benefiting the producer at the expense of the consumer. This is done through policies such as tariffs on imports, which push up prices for consumers. Consumers end up paying higher prices while domestic producers benefit from increased profits.

Step-by-step explanation:

Protectionism is a method of requiring consumers to subsidize producers, benefiting the producer at the expense of the consumer. This is because protectionist policies such as tariffs on imports push up prices for consumers in the country implementing them.

For example, a tariff is a scale of taxes on imports designed to protect domestic producers against the greed of consumers. While protectionism may benefit domestic producers by increasing their profits, consumers end up paying higher prices for goods and services.

Therefore, protectionism can be seen as a means of benefiting the producer at the expense of the consumer, as consumers are required to indirectly subsidize producers through higher prices.
